China places top PLA leaders Zhang Youxia and Liu Zhenli under investigation
Top Chinese military leaders Zhang Youxia and Liu Zhenli have been placed under investigation for suspected “serious violations of discipline and law”, the Ministry of National Defence says. More to f...
7hSouth China Morning PostPoliticsImpact